#F820C2 Color
#F820C2 is rgb(248, 32, 194) in RGB, hsl(315, 94%, 55%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 87%, 22%, 3%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Shocking Pink (#FC0FC0),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 2.86.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#F820C2 Channel Values
How #F820C2 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 248 · G 32 · B 194 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 315° · S 94% · L 55%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 315° · S 87% · V 97%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 87% · Y 22% · K 3%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.51:1 vs white · 5.98: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#F820C2 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#F820C2?
#F820C2 is a mid-tone pink — rgb(248, 32, 194) in RGB and hsl(315, 94%, 55%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Shocking Pink (#FC0FC0),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 2.86.
What is the RGB value of #F820C2?
#F820C2 is rgb(248, 32, 194) — red 248, green 32, and blue 194 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#F820C2?
#F820C2 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 87%, 22%, 3%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#F820C2 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#F820C2 scores 3.51:1 against white and 5.98: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#F820C2 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#F820C2 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umvioletred (#C71585) at a CIE76 distance of 25.04, which is a different colour altogether.
